Contexts with "se mener à bien"

Le candidat a-t-il les capacités qui conviennent pour mener à bien le travail ? Does the applicant have suitable abilities to carry out the job?
Sans votre aide, nous ne serions pas en mesure de mener à bien notre plan. Without your help, we wouldn't be able to carry out our plan.
C'est vrai que le projet est une tâche difficile, mais M. Hara sera capable d'en venir à bout (de le mener à bien). It's true that the project is a difficult task, but Mr Hara will be able to bring it off.
Nous n'avons pu mener à bien notre projet à cause d'un manque de fonds. We couldn't carry out our project because of a lack of funds.
